Are you planning on buying an engineered wood floor? If so there are a lot of things to consider:

What is the veneer thickness and how is it finished? The substrate is very significant. If it is manufactured with the proper adhesive then you will be OK (isocyanate or phenolic resins you should be good to go).

But, China has no formaldehyde emission standards so if it is manufactured with a formaldehyde-containing adhesive, you may have very high emissions and/or marginal properties. Buyer beware! Lots and lots of things to questions.
